How they compare
Zambia currently reports 49.33 against 49.26 in United Arab Emirates, a difference of 0.07.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 17 shared years of data; in 2003 it was United Arab Emirates ahead.
United Arab Emirates ranks 78th and Zambia ranks 77th of 188 countries.
United Arab Emirates has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
The score for resolving insolvency is the simple average of the scores for each of the component indicators: the recovery rate of insolvency proceedings involving domestic entities, as well as the strength of the legal framework applicable to judicial liquidation and reorganization proceedings.
